This script allow you to quickly change the version of PHP running on the system.
- You need to have installed at least two versions of
php
-
Download and unzip in any folder (for example, in
/home/YOUR_NAME/bin/
) -
Open a terminal emulator and go to the folder where you extracted the script
-
When you're in the same folder that contains the script, type the following code:
sudo chmod +x change-php-version.sh
-
Type the following code:
sudo ./change-php-version.sh PHP_VERSION
where PHP_VERSION
is the version of PHP that you want to enable. The script will automatically disable the current version before of enabling the new one.
Suppose you want to enable the version 5.6
of PHP; you have to type in terminal
sudo ./change-php-version.sh 5.6
